Afrikaans
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/rəi/
Etymology 1
From Dutch rij.
Noun
ry (plural rye)
- row
Etymology 2
From Dutch rijden.
Verb
ry (present ry, present participle ryende, past participle gery)
- to ride
- to drive

Manx
Preposition
ry
- obsolete form of rish
Usage notes
Only used in set phrases, e.g.:
- ry-cheilley (“together”)
- ry-heet (“pending, future, forthcoming”)
- bun ry skyn (“inverted, disordered, topsy-turvy”)

Norwegian Nynorsk
Noun
ry n (definite singular ryet, uncountable)
- fame, renown
- reputation
Synonyms
- rykte
Verb
ry (present tense ryr, past tense rydde or raud, supine rydd/rydt or rode, past participle rydd or rode, present participle ryande)
- (transitive) to sprinkle
- (intransitive) to smolder up
